Inclusion Criteria
- •. Written informed consent/assent from the subject and/or a legal representative prior to initiation of any study-mandated procedures.
- •. Subjects who have completed Week 52 of AC-055H301 RUBATO DB.
- •. Women of childbearing potential must:
- •- Have a negative serum pregnancy test prior to first intake of OL study drug, and,
- •- Agree to perform monthly pregnancy tests up to the end of the safety follow up (S-FU) period, and,
- •- use reliable methods of contraception from enrollment up to at least 30 days after study treatment discontinuation

Exclusion Criteria
- •. Clinical worsening leading to medical interventions including reoperation of Fontan circulation (Fontan take-down) during the enrollment period.
- •. Systolic blood pressure < 90 mmHg (< 85 mmHg for subjects < 18 years old and < 150 cm of height) at rest.
- •. Criteria related to macitentan use
- •. Any known factor or disease that may interfere with treatment compliance or full participation in the study.
